was up bright and early this morning and decided it was a nice day for a full detail.
set to work with the snow foam then used washing up liquid to remove all the layers and then a steam clean to remove the dirt.
then out came the clay bar for a good rub down,
then steam cleaned again with isopropyl alcohol ready for the polish.
got out the DA polisher and brought back the shine, this was buffed off with more isopropyl ready for the protection.
put 1 layer of synthetic sealant on then 1 layer of hard wax. was a long 8 hour sesh but the car looked great.
